Other than paying whatever bill a debt collector is trying to collect, consumers have a limited number of ways to make one who is contacting them stop doing so. The most effective way to stop a debt collector in his tracks is to mail him a "cease and desist" letter in accordance with Section 805(c) of the Fair Debt Collection Practices Act (the FDCPA).
